In 2021, Hope, AR had a population of 9.01k people with a median age of 37.4 and a median household income of $42,122. Between 2020 and 2021 the population of Hope, AR declined from 9,668 to 9,010, a −6.81% decrease and its median household income grew from $39,793 to $42,122, a 5.85% increase.
The 5 largest ethnic groups in Hope, AR are Black or African American (Non-Hispanic) (43.7%), White (Non-Hispanic) (36.5%), Other (Hispanic) (10.9%), Two+ (Hispanic) (3.01%), and White (Hispanic) (2.87%).
None of the households in Hope, AR reported speaking a non-English language at home as their primary shared language. This does not consider the potential multi-lingual nature of households, but only the primary self-reported language spoken by all members of the household.
94.5% of the residents in Hope, AR are U.S. citizens.
The largest universities in Hope, AR are University of Arkansas Hope-Texarkana (544 degrees awarded in 2021).
In 2021, the median property value in Hope, AR was $83,200, and the homeownership rate was 54.1%.
Most people in Hope, AR drove alone to work, and the average commute time was 19.5 minutes. The average car ownership in Hope, AR was 2 cars per household.
